This event group covers a women's college basketball game between Tarleton State Texans and UT Arlington Mavericks scheduled for March 5, 2026 at 6:30 PM ET. Markets on Polymarket and Kalshi are tracking the outcome of this matchup, with resolution based on the final score including overtime.
Kalshi's resolution statement contains a logical contradiction where both possible game outcomes are stated to resolve to Yes, making the market fundamentally unresolvable. This represents a data integrity failure that prevents proper settlement.

Critical Divergence Points:
Polymarket: Binary winner-take-all structure with clear mutually exclusive outcomes. Resolves to team name of winner based on final score including overtime. Postponements keep market open; total cancellations resolve 50-50. Source: NCAA.org.
Kalshi: Resolution statement indicates both UT Arlington win and Tarleton St. win resolve to Yes, which is logically impossible. This appears to be either a data transcription error or a critical market design flaw that prevents settlement.
